#510894 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#510894 is composed of 31.8% red, 3.1%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.3% cyan, 94.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 271.3 degrees, a saturation of 89.7% and a lightness of 30.6%. #510894 color hex could be obtained by blending #a210ff with #000029.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

#510894 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#510894 has RGB values of R:81, G:8,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 5310612.

Shades and Tints of #510894
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0112 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.
